Differential pressure transmitter is used to prevent the medium in the pipeline from directly entering the transmitter. The pressure sensing diaphragm is connected to the transmitter by a capillary tube filled with fluid. It is used to measure the liquid level, flow rate, and pressure of liquids, gases, or vapors, and then convert them into 4-20mA DC signal output. Differential pressure transmitters are suitable for the following measurement and control situations:
● Viscous media at high temperatures
● Medium that is prone to crystallization
● Sedimentation media with solid particles or suspended solids
● Strong corrosive or highly toxic media
Can eliminate the occurrence of pressure pipe leakage and pollution of the surrounding environment; It can avoid the tedious work of frequently replenishing isolation fluid due to the instability of measurement signals when using isolation fluid.
Continuous and precise measurement of interface and density
The remote transmission device can avoid the mixing of different instantaneous media, thus enabling the measurement results to truly reflect the actual situation of process changes.
Places with high hygiene and cleanliness requirements
In the production of food, beverage, and pharmaceutical industries, it is not only required that the contact area of the transmitter with the medium meet hygiene standards, but also be easy to rinse
Prevent cross contamination of different media.
As the name suggests, the result measured by a differential pressure transmitter is the pressure difference, that is, △ P=ρ g △ h. Since oil tanks are often cylindrical, the area S of their cross-sectional circle remains constant. Therefore, gravity G=△ P · S=ρ g △ h · S, S remains constant, and G is proportional to △ P. As long as the Δ P value is accurately detected and proportional to the height Δ h, the pressure detected remains constant even when the volume of the oil expands or shrinks and the actual liquid level rises or falls during temperature changes. If the user needs to display the actual liquid level, medium temperature compensation can also be introduced to solve the problem.
Target audience: liquids, gases, and vapors
Measurement range: 0-0.1kPa to 0-40MPa
Output signal: 4-20mA DC (special for four wire 220V AC power supply, 0-10mA DC output)
Power supply: 12-45V DC, usually 24V DC
Load characteristics: Related to the power supply, the load capacity at a certain power supply voltage is shown in Figure 2. The relationship between load impedance RL and power supply voltage Vs is: RL ≤ 50 (Vs-12)
Indicator: pointer type linear indication 0~scale or LCD liquid crystal display.
Explosion proof: Explosion proof ExdIICT6
Range and zero point: externally continuously adjustable
Positive and negative transfer: The values of the upper and lower limits of the range and measurement range after the zero point undergoes positive or negative transfer,
All cannot exceed the upper limit of the measurement range. (Intelligent type: Range ratio 15:1) The maximum positive transfer is 500% of the minimum calibration range; The maximum negative transfer is 600% of the minimum calibration range.
Temperature range: The working temperature range of the amplifier is -29 to+93 ℃ (LT type is -25 to+70 ℃).
Measuring element filled with silicone oil: -40 to+104 ℃
When filling high-temperature silicone oil into flange type transmitters: -20~+315 ℃, ordinary silicone oil: -40~+149 ℃
Static pressure: 4, 10, 25, 32MPa
Humidity: Relative humidity is 5-95%
Volume suction capacity:<0.16cm3
Damping (step response): When filled with silicone oil, it is generally continuously adjustable between 0.2s and 1.67s.
Accuracy: ± 0.2%
Dead zone: None (≤ 0.1%)
Stability: Within six months (one year for intelligent models), the basic error value should not exceed the maximum range
Vibration effect: In any axial direction, when the vibration frequency is 200Hz, the error is ± 0.05%/g of the upper limit of the measurement range
Power supply impact: less than 0.005%/V of the output range
Load impact: If the power supply is stable, the load is not affected.
